Valley’s normal life hit as mercury dips to 2



KATHMANDU: Normal life has been affected as the temperature went down to 2 degree Celsius in the Kathmandu Valley on Friday morning.

This is the record low temperature of this year, according to Manju Basi, a meteorologist. It was recorded at 6:45 am.  It was 2.3 degree Celsius yesterday morning.

The temperature has been going down since the last few days across the country.

The weather is partly cloudy in the hilly areas of Province 1, Bagmati Province and Gandaki Province and mainly fair in rest of the Province, according to a weather bulletin issued by the Meteorological Forecasting Division (MFD).
